Transaction 67a05017e813d876fa99a34e999f93ed5bf3bfa7cb49f5a149cf4516247fc588
1 Input
1 Output
-
67a05017e813d876fa99a34e999f93ed5bf3bfa7cb49f5a149cf4516247fc588:0
- value
- 134260
- script pubkey
- OP_0 OP_PUSHBYTES_20 22702032c78115e7d3129bb2d13316ff6128da67
- address
- bc1qyfczqvk8sy2705cjnwedzvcklasj3kn80pjc07